Analytical Mechanics Associates (AMA) is seeking to hire an experienced aerospace thermal engineer.

The successful candidate will primarily support the Structural and Thermal Analysis (STSB) branch at NASA Langley Research Center in Hampton, VA by preparing and solving Thermal Desktop models, documenting the analysis, presenting/reporting findings, guiding design and manufacturing, and verifying results using testing. Models may vary from Ground Support Equipment (GSE) or test fixturing to flight vehicles or satellites.

Salary range: $135,000-$195,000 commensurate with education and relevant professional experience.

Required Qualifications
  • Minimum of bachelor’s degree in engineering from an accredited university.
  • Proven use of Thermal Desktop with at least 5,000 hours of experience, and documenting analysis, presenting findings, guiding design and manufacturing, and verifying results through testing.
  • Experience leading and mentoring less experienced engineers.
  • Familiarity with Microsoft Office suite (Word and PowerPoint) and ability to document reports and technical memos.
  • US citizenship (required for ITAR compliance).
Desired Qualifications
  • Master’s degree or Ph.D. in a related field.
  • Experience in performing Structural, Thermal and Optical Performance (STOP) analysis.
  • Experience with Model Based Systems Engineering (MBSE) and/or MBSE Multidisciplinary Design Analysis and Optimization (MDAO), including optimization and sensitivity studies scripting for system-based analysis.
  • Python programming or similar experience.
  • Working knowledge of PTC/Creo software.
  • Ability to use other software to solve thermal problems and programming capability.
